Get a Free Vending Machine Quote!

Random Listing

Unit 12 The Tanyard, Leigh Rd

Street, Wiltshire

41-42 Kew Bridge Road

Brentford, Greater London

6 Devonshire Court, Victoria Road

Feltham, Greater London

1 Landsberg, Litchfield Road Industrial Estate

Tamworth, Staffordshire

Unit 17 Lanesfield Drive, Wolverhampton

Wolverhampton, West Midlands